Woody - I haven't tried any transplants into a DeLorean yet, but I
have one of these engines in a kit car project of mine. I have the
1963 Oldsmobile variant which has 6 head bolts per cylinder. The
Buick version has 5, and the Pontiac version, 4. This engine family
was sold to British Leyland years ago, and is now the Rover 3.5L V-
8. You are right in that this is a great little motor. I don't
know if it's really all that small compared to a small-block Chevy,
but it is light! I have one mated to a VW transaxle in a Sterling
GT kit. It would probably be better for somebody to use the Rover
version for the DeLorean, as parts for the American versions are a
bit tough to come by. I suspect that somebody would have done the
Rover conversion by now(?)in a DeLorean.
